Documentation of Russian artist Grisha Bruskin's monumental, multi-part "Alefbet" tapestry project created in collaboration with a team of Russian weavers. 160 mythological characters populate the tapestries and are indexed in a detailed glossary. The tapestries are united by themes from Biblical, mythological, Kabbalistic and folklore traditions, as interpreted by the artist. With commentary by the artist, and art critics Yevgeny Barabanov, Boris Groys, and Vitaly Patsukov.
